Contents pt. 1. Interfaces with syntax and phonology -- pt. 2. Interfaces with semantics and the lexicon -- pt. 3. Interfaces in psycholinguistics and language acquisition.
Summary One of the most striking trends across linguistic research in recent years has been the examination of the interfaces between the various subcomponents of the language faculty. Yet, approaches to these interfaces across different theoretical frameworks differ substantially. This volume pulls together research into Morphology and its interfaces from researchers employing a variety of different theoretical and methodological perspectives: Morphology is a diverse field, and rather than aiming to collect works sharing a particular approach or framework of assumptions, this collection instead captu.
